How Understanding the Delicate Balance: Stanislaus County Public Defender's Role Actually Works

At its core, the public defenderโ€™s role is to ensure that every individual, regardless of financial means, has professional legal representation in criminal proceedings. In Stanislaus County, this office operates under strict ethical rules and constitutional obligations. When a person is charged with a crime and cannot afford a private attorney, the court appoints a public defender. These lawyers review evidence, interview witnesses, and negotiate with prosecutors on behalf of their clients. For example, if someone is charged with a misdemeanor theft, the public defender might examine surveillance footage, check for procedural errors, or explore diversion programs. The Understanding the Delicate Balance: Stanislaus County Public Defender's Role involves balancing zealous advocacy with practical realities, such as crowded dockets and limited staff. Each decision is guided by a duty to provide competent and fair representation while working within the framework of the law.

What Does a Public Defender Actually Do on a Daily Basis?

A public defenderโ€™s day often begins long before stepping into a courtroom. They review files, meet with clients in holding cells or detention centers, and coordinate with investigators. In many cases, they must decide quickly whether to pursue a plea deal or proceed to trial. Consider a scenario where a first-time offender is charged with drug possession. The public defender might argue for treatment programs instead of incarceration, presenting a plan to the judge. This requires not only legal knowledge but also strong communication skills. The Understanding the Delicate Balance: Stanislaus County Public Defender's Role is evident in how these professionals manage heavy workloads while maintaining attention to detail. Their work ensures that the accused is not presumed guilty by circumstance, but treated according to due process.

How Are Cases Prioritized in a Busy Public Defender Office?

With limited resources, offices must prioritize cases based on urgency and complexity. Felony cases, such as those involving violence or significant prison time, are typically handled first. Misdemeanor and probation violation cases follow, often handled through streamlined procedures. Technology has helped streamline workflows, with case management systems allowing defenders to track deadlines and documents efficiently. However, human judgment remains central. The Understanding the Delicate Balance: Stanislaus County Public Defender's Role includes making difficult decisions about which cases to take on personally and which can be delegated to junior staff or paralegals. This structured approach helps maintain consistency and ensures that clients receive timely support, even in high-volume environments.

Many individuals wonder how the public defender system differs from private legal representation. One key distinction is that public defenders are appointed by the court and funded by public dollars. While private attorneys are hired directly by clients, public defenders operate under county oversight and must adhere to strict workload guidelines. Another frequent question is about client choice. In most situations, defendants do not get to select their public defender but are assigned an attorney based on availability. Some also ask whether public defenders can be as effective as private lawyers. The reality is that experienced public defenders often handle hundreds of cases per year, developing deep familiarity with local courts and prosecutors. Things People Often Misunderstand

Misconceptions about public defenders can distort public perception. One common myth is that they are less qualified than private attorneys. In truth, public defenders must meet the same licensing and ethical standards as any lawyer. Another misunderstanding is that they push clients toward guilty pleas to close cases quickly. In reality, plea decisions are carefully evaluated, with emphasis on what truly serves the clientโ€™s interests.
